Output 3ecb4d7909cdebfdb48903a3682b4456dbc43c17077e0e54b423a3a057a52a2f:0

value
12322831
script pubkey
OP_0 OP_PUSHBYTES_20 3aedb8cbd66b57ed6a35f44d124fa503df497e02
address
bc1q8tkm3j7kddt7663473x3yna9q005jlszphluat
transaction
3ecb4d7909cdebfdb48903a3682b4456dbc43c17077e0e54b423a3a057a52a2f
spent
true